    Cracked it! Home button,settings and scroll to second page. Click OK on Freesat channels icon,select favourite channels then edit favourite channels. Choose favourites and then press back button to save.

    Menu Settings Right 3 times to more. OK on Freesat Channels - OK on Edit favourite channels. OK on channels you want as favourites. Press back to save.

    To apply favourites filter to guide.

    Guide - List - Up - OK

    Note setting isn't sticky. You need the above every time you press guide.
